Compare Twine vs Burrell Stockbroking Commission And Fees
Twine and Burrell Stockbroking are online brokerage platforms, and many online brokerages charge lower fees than traditional brokerages tend to charge. The reason for this is that the companies of online trading platforms are scaled much better. That is, an internet broker is not necessarily affected by the number of clients they have.
But this does not necessarily mean that online brokers don't charge any fees. They charge fees of varying rates for various services to earn money. There are primarily 3 types of fees for this objective.
The first kind of charges to keep an eye out for are trading charges. When you make a genuine trade, like purchasing a stock or an ETF, you are billed trading fees. In these instances, you are spending a spread, funding speed, or even a commission. The kinds of trading fees and the rates differ from broker to broker.
Commissions could be fixed or dependent on the traded quantity. On the other hand, a spread refers to the difference between the buying and selling price. Funding or overnight prices are those that are charged when you maintain a leveraged position for more than a day.
Apart from trading charges, online brokers also bill non-trading fees. These are determined by the activities you undertake on your accounts. They are charged for surgeries like depositing cash, not investing for lengthy periods, or withdrawals.
